GHI Deck Main Components
Panel size in cm weight in kg
180 x 180 52,10
180 x 90 24,60
180 x 75 21,30
180 x 60 18,40
180 x 45 15,30
Panel size in cm weight in kg
90 x 90 13,40
90 x 75 11,70
90 x 60 9,80
90 x 45 7,90
 5 panels with 180cm width and 4 panels with 90cm width
 Flexible use due to additional adjustment beams for both widths
Aluminum Panels
 All-purpose, versatile and durable
 Handy and light with all around edge protection and powder coating
 Easy assembly and disassembly of the panels through their little weight
 Divided in 9 different sizes in 2 different widths
 Up to 3.24 m² forming area with the 180 cm x 180 cm big panel
 10 mm thick shuttering plates made of birch wood with a 220 g / m² phenolic resin coating
 All elements variably combinable with each other
 Compatible with other manufactures
GHI Deck Main Components
Steel Props
 Flexible through various extension lengths up to 5.50 m
 Different load capacities up to 30 kN
 Low weight despite high load capacity
 Galvanized
 Absolute stability
 All steel props are combinable with all panels
 Including fail safe and squeeze protection
Length in m Load capacity Weight in kg
1,46 - 2,50 20 kN 13,00
1,80 - 3,00 20 kN 15,50
2,00 - 3,50 20 kN 20,50
2,24 - 4,00 20 kN 23,50
3,00 - 5,50 20 kN 31,00
Length in m Load capacity Weight in kg
1,80 - 3,00 30 kN 19,01
2,00 - 3,50 30 kN 22,20
 30 kN load capacity for massive slabs
 One universal tripod for all steel props
GHI Deck Accessories
Drop Head & Plastic Infill 180
 Allows a timesaving and easy disassembly, thus are less
panels necessary
 Plastic Infill 180 is placed on 2 Drop Heads and covers the
free space between the panels, which arise from the usage
of the Drop Head
Railing Post
 Is inserted into the Bearing for Railing or the Railing Shoe
 Support for wooden railing
Bearing for Railing
 To mount the Railing Post at the outer edges
 Is mounted on the Steel Prop and secured with a bolt
Transverse Beam
 Is mounted across to the Adjustment Beams into their guard rail
 Usage in the 90 grid
 Support for the plywood
 With integrated wooden strip
Railing Shoe
 Used for the mounting at the panel
 Allows the sideways mount of the Railing Post before swinging
up the panels
Adjustment Beam 180 & 90
 12 cm high aluminum beam with integrated wooden strip
 Serve as support for the plywood in adjustment areas
Head Support Shoe
 Is mounted on the Bearing or Edge Support
 Allows the support of square timbers in adjustment areas
Bearing & Edge Support
 Support for the panels
 Is mounted on the steel prop and secured with a bolt
 Edge Support is used on the outer edges of the formwork
GHI Deck Accessories
Bolt for Steel Props
 Secures the connection between the Steel Props and the
Bearing or Edge Support
 12 and 15 mm diameter depending on the Prop
Universal Tripod
 Helps arranging the Steel Props
 Usable for all Steel and Aluminum Props
Stacking Angle
 With the Stacking Angle 7 Panels can be stacked about
each other
 Allows an easy and secure transport
Erection Rod & Extension
 Help for the assembly and disassembly of the Panels from
the ground
 Variable length adjustment
Panel Tension Strap
 Serves as a falling protection for slab formwork
 Prevent the tipping of the Panels in cantilever
arrangements
Alu Prop Adapter
 Connection between the Bearing and Aluminum Props
Fixing Head
 The Fixing Head helps to fix the Props and secures
against falling
 Used in cantilever arrangements of Panels
 Engages into the inner profile of the Panel
